How to Add Express Menu in AutoCAD?

Accessing the Express Menu in AutoCAD

To effectively utilize the Express Tools within AutoCAD, following the right steps is crucial. Express Tools are a series of functions designed to enhance productivity, making certain tasks simpler and more efficient. Here’s how to access and enable the Express Menu in AutoCAD.

Step-by-Step Guide to Access the Express Menu

  1. Open AutoCAD:
    Start by launching the AutoCAD application on your computer. Make sure you are in the workspace where you want to add the Express Tools.

  2. Check for the Ribbon:
    Look for the Ribbon at the top of your AutoCAD interface. If the Express Tools tab is visible, you can click on it directly to access the tools. If it’s not there, proceed to the next step.

  3. Access the Command Prompt:
    Click on the command line at the bottom of the AutoCAD window. This is where you can input commands directly.

  4. Enter the Command for the Express Menu:
    Type EXPRESSMENU at the Command prompt and hit Enter. This command will activate the Express menu, allowing you to access various tools.

  5. Display Toolbars:
    If you want to see toolbars containing Express Tools, right-click near any docked toolbar. A context menu will appear. From this menu, select "EXPRESS" to display a dropdown where you can choose which Express toolbar to show.

  6. Verifying Installation:
    If you don’t see the Express menu or toolbar after following the above steps, you might need to ensure that the Express Tools are installed properly.

Installing Express Tools in AutoCAD 2025

To ensure that Express Tools are available, you may need to perform installation steps:

  1. Open Programs and Features:
    Navigate to the Windows Control Panel and open "Programs and Features."

  2. Modify AutoCAD:
    Locate AutoCAD from the list of installed programs, right-click it, and select the option to modify or change the program.

  3. Select Features to Add:
    When the program setup window appears, look for the "Add or Remove Features" icon. Click on it.

  4. Enable Express Tools:
    In the list of features, find "Express Tools" and check the corresponding box. After making your selection, proceed by clicking the update or next button.

  5. Restart AutoCAD:
    Once the installation completes, restart AutoCAD. The Express Tools tab should now be accessible from the Ribbon.

Functions of Express Tools in AutoCAD

Express Tools encompass a variety of functionalities that enhance the capabilities of AutoCAD. These tools allow for quicker and more efficient operations, particularly in drafting and modifying designs. Common tools within this category include:

  • Block and Attribute Management
    Tools for creating and managing blocks and attributes with ease.

  • Selection Tools
    Enhanced selection features that simplify object handling.

  • Text Manipulation
    Quick ways to edit, format, and place text in your drawings.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Are Express Tools available in AutoCAD LT?
Express Tools are not included in AutoCAD LT. They are exclusive to the full version of AutoCAD and its vertical products.

2. Do I need to purchase Express Tools separately?
No, Express Tools are included in the standard installation of AutoCAD. However, they may require specific installation steps as outlined above.

3. Can I customize the toolbars in AutoCAD?
Yes, AutoCAD allows you to customize your toolbars. Go to the Manage tab, access the Customization panel, and adjust the toolbars according to your preferences.
